Das Phallus Syndrom is one of those strange entries from the early '90s that leaves you scratching your head. It's got this bizarre blend of dark humor and surreal visuals that really sets an unsettling tone. The pacing? A bit erratic, but it somehow adds to the off-kilter atmosphere. The performances are intriguing, often teetering on the edge of absurdity, which aligns well with its themes of identity and societal norms. Practical effects are a highlight, lending a tangible weirdness that feels refreshing compared to today’s digital overload. You won't find much information about the director, which only adds to its enigmatic charm.
Das Phallus Syndrom is relatively scarce and often sought after by collectors of underground and cult cinema. Its obscure nature and lack of reliable documentation make it an interesting piece for those diving into early '90s oddities. Various formats have been released, but it’s the limited editions that catch the eye of collectors, reflecting a niche interest in the film's peculiar blend of humor and horror.
